Solving equations and inequalities.

I’m confused on the subtraction behind the one, am I supposed to turn the one into a negative?

1-(4+3x)<-3

Answer:

x>0

Answer to your question:

Because the subtraction sign is after the negative, it applies to the term in front of it, in this case because there is a parenthesis, it would multiply into that and your equation from there would be 1-4-3x<-3. Then combine like terms from there.
